PCOD problem
My ultrasound scan result. Right ovary measures 3.9 x 1.7 x 3.3 cm, volume-12.2 cc.  Left ovary measures 3.8 x 3.5 x 1.6 cm, volume-11.8 cc.  Bilateral mildly bulky ovaries with few immature follicles. Please explain the issue and what should i do to prevent PCOD??
